Emily Ratajkowski is the face of the new Viktor&Rolf FLOWERBOMB campaign. The American New York Times best-selling author, actress, model, activist and entrepreneur redefines what it means to be wholly female. Her debut essay collection “My Body” was released by Metropolitan Books, solidified by her New York Magazine essay – the magazine’s most-read story of 2020 – entitled “Buying Myself Back,” which led to the discourse around copyright and image ownership. Launched 18 years ago by the Dutch avant-garde luxury fashion house, Viktor&Rolf FLOWERBOMB remains in the Top 10 US women’s fragrances and the Top 15 UK women’s fragrances since its release in 2005. The fragrance set the standard for floral gourmand fragrances and signals a new chapter of fragrance femininity.

In her first collaboration with the brand, the model appears in the fragrance’s film short directed by filmmakers Torso Solutions, featuring imagery directed and captured by photographers Inez & Vinoodh. In it, Ratajkowski explores the extraordinary power of transformation pushed to the extreme.
